Cursive Mylum 6 is a regular weight, narrow, low contrast, italic, short x-height font.

A lively monoline script with gently rounded terminals and frequent looped joins. Strokes keep an even thickness and lean consistently, while letterforms vary in width for a natural handwritten rhythm. Ascenders and descenders are prominent and often finish with soft curls, and counters stay open enough to keep the texture light. Capitals are more decorative than the lowercase, featuring larger entry/exit strokes and occasional swash-like curves that add flair without becoming overly ornate.

Well suited for short to medium display text where a personal touch is desirable—greeting cards, invitations, boutique branding, packaging labels, social posts, and quote graphics. It can also work for headings or pull quotes in lifestyle contexts, especially when paired with a simple sans for body copy.

The overall tone is warm and personable, like a neat marker signature or a friendly note. Its looping forms and buoyant rhythm feel upbeat and approachable, giving text a conversational, human presence rather than a formal calligraphic one.

Likely intended to provide an easygoing cursive voice that feels handwritten yet controlled, with consistent stroke weight and clean loops for reliable reproduction. The design emphasizes charm and readability over strict formality, aiming for a versatile script that can headline without overwhelming a layout.

Spacing and joins create an intermittently connected flow: many lowercase letters link smoothly, but the script also tolerates small breaks, reinforcing an authentic hand-drawn feel. Numerals follow the same rounded, simple construction, staying consistent with the script’s casual character.
